Fix for T77111: Joins Areas Without Creating Invalid Edges

Properly align every involved edge when performing 'tolerant' area joins.

Differential Revision: https://developer.blender.org/D7859

Reviewed by Brecht Van Lommel

+/* Screen verts with horizontal position equal to from_x are moved to to_x. */
+static void screen_verts_halign(const wmWindow *win,
+                                const bScreen *screen,
+                                const short from_x,
+                                const short to_x)
+{
+  ED_screen_verts_iter(win, screen, v1)
+  {
+    if (v1->vec.x == from_x) {
+      v1->vec.x = to_x;
+    }
+  }
+}
+
+/* Screen verts with vertical position equal to from_y are moved to to_y. */
+static void screen_verts_valign(const wmWindow *win,
+                                const bScreen *screen,
+                                const short from_y,
+                                const short to_y)
+{
+  ED_screen_verts_iter(win, screen, v1)
+  {
+    if (v1->vec.y == from_y) {
+      v1->vec.y = to_y;
+    }
+  }
+}
+
+/* Adjust all screen edges to allow joining two areas. 'dir' value is like area_getorientation().
+ */
+static void screen_areas_align(
+    bContext *C, bScreen *screen, ScrArea *sa1, ScrArea *sa2, const int dir)
+{
+  wmWindow *win = CTX_wm_window(C);
+
+  if (dir == 0 || dir == 2) {
+    /* horizontal join, use average for new top and bottom. */
+    int top = (sa1->v2->vec.y + sa2->v2->vec.y) / 2;
+    int bottom = (sa1->v4->vec.y + sa2->v4->vec.y) / 2;
+
+    /* Move edges exactly matching source top and bottom. */
+    screen_verts_valign(win, screen, sa1->v2->vec.y, top);
+    screen_verts_valign(win, screen, sa1->v4->vec.y, bottom);
+
+    /* Move edges exactly matching target top and bottom. */
+    screen_verts_valign(win, screen, sa2->v2->vec.y, top);
+    screen_verts_valign(win, screen, sa2->v4->vec.y, bottom);
+  }
+  else {
+    /* Vertical join, use averages for new left and right. */
+    int left = (sa1->v1->vec.x + sa2->v1->vec.x) / 2;
+    int right = (sa1->v3->vec.x + sa2->v3->vec.x) / 2;
+
+    /* Move edges exactly matching source left and right. */
+    screen_verts_halign(win, screen, sa1->v1->vec.x, left);
+    screen_verts_halign(win, screen, sa1->v3->vec.x, right);
+
+    /* Move edges exactly matching target left and right */
+    screen_verts_halign(win, screen, sa2->v1->vec.x, left);
+    screen_verts_halign(win, screen, sa2->v3->vec.x, right);
+  }
+}
+
